Car Destroyed In Fire Southwest Of Archer

Archer, Iowa– A car was destroyed in a fire on Friday, July 29, 2022, near Archer.

According to Archer Fire Chief Don De Boer, at about 6:45 p.m., the Archer Fire Department was called to the report of a vehicle fire at 5268 390th Street, two miles south of Archer and a half mile west.

The chief says the fire department saw the car fully engulfed in flame as they approached the scene. He says they used water and firefighting foam to fight the fire.

De Boer says no injuries were reported and the occupants were able to exit the car, which was a 2010s-era Chevy.

He tells us there was initially some confusion about where the car was, so the Primghar Fire Department was also paged, and they responded as well.

He says the cause of the fire appeared to be electrical in nature.

Chief De Boer reports that the vehicle was totaled in the blaze.

He says the firefighters who responded were on the scene for about 45 minutes.
